Ingredients

Ingredients for Lemon Chicken Quinoa Bowls
  • 1 1/2 pounds boneless, skinless chicken breasts, trimmed (680 g)
  • 1 cup dry quinoa, thoroughly rinsed (170 g)
  • 2 medium zucchini, cut into half-moons (400 g)
  • 2 red bell peppers, cut into wide strips (300 g)
  • 2 cups cherry tomatoes, whole or halved (300 g)
  • 2 tablespoons olive oil (27 g)
  • 1 tablespoon finely grated lemon zest (6 g)
  • 3 tablespoons fresh lemon juice (45 g)
  • 1 teaspoon garlic powder (3 g)
  • 3/4 teaspoon kosher salt (4 g)
  • 1/2 cup chopped fresh parsley (30 g)

Ingredient notes

  • Boneless, skinless chicken breasts keep the cooking method simple. Pound thicker ends lightly so the pieces finish at a similar rate, then cut only after resting to hold their juices better on the plate later.
  • Use rinsed quinoa for a cleaner flavor and fluffy grains. Cook it in water or gluten-free broth, checking the label if broth is part of your plan. Let it stand before fluffing with a fork.
  • Zucchini roasts best when cut into sturdy half-moons rather than thin slices. Spread it across the pan with space around each piece so moisture can evaporate during roasting instead of steaming the edges too much.
  • Red bell pepper adds sweetness and color, while cherry tomatoes soften and release juices. Keep tomato pieces whole or halved so they stay substantial beside the chicken. Choose firm tomatoes without split skins for roasting.
  • Fresh parsley brings a grassy finish that dried herbs cannot fully replace. Zest the lemon before juicing it, then reserve a little juice for the final bowl assembly. This keeps the flavor bright and defined.

How to make Lemon Chicken Quinoa Bowls

  1. Heat oven

    Set the oven to 425°F and line two rimmed sheet pans with parchment. Place one rack in the upper third and one in the lower third. Set a small saucepan with water on the stove. Measure the remaining ingredients while the oven heats.

  2. Season chicken

    Pat the chicken dry and place it on one prepared pan. Rub with half the olive oil, lemon zest, oregano, garlic powder, and salt. Turn each piece once so the seasoning is distributed evenly over both sides.

  3. Prepare vegetables

    Add zucchini, peppers, and tomatoes to the second pan. Drizzle with the remaining oil, season lightly with salt, and toss directly on the pan. Spread the vegetables into one layer, leaving open space between the pieces.

  4. Cook quinoa

    Bring the saucepan of water to a boil, add the rinsed quinoa, and reduce to a gentle simmer. Cover and cook until the grains are tender and the water is absorbed. Remove from heat and let it sit covered for five minutes.

  5. Roast pans

    Put both pans in the oven and roast for 18 to 22 minutes, rotating their positions halfway through. Bake the chicken until its center reaches 165°F. The vegetables should be browned at the edges and tender when pierced with a fork.

  6. Rest and assemble

    Transfer chicken to a board and rest it for five minutes before slicing. Fluff quinoa with a fork and stir in half the lemon juice and parsley. Divide quinoa, vegetables, and chicken among four bowls, then finish with remaining lemon juice and parsley.

Tips

  • Use similarly sized chicken pieces so they finish together. If one breast is notably thick, flatten the thick end gently rather than extending the roasting time for every piece.
  • Rinse quinoa in a fine-mesh sieve until the water runs mostly clear. This small step improves its texture and prevents loose grains from scattering when you transfer it to the saucepan.
  • Keep vegetables in a single layer. Crowding traps steam, which leaves zucchini soft before its edges have time to brown and makes the tomatoes release more liquid across the pan.
  • Slice the rested chicken across the grain into even strips. Even pieces distribute more cleanly through four bowls and make the final assembly less uneven.

Serving and storage

Serve each bowl warm with lemon wedges and a spoonful of plain Greek yogurt or dairy-free yogurt if a creamy finish is wanted. A handful of arugula, sliced cucumber, or diced avocado rounds out the vegetables without changing the main preparation. For dinner, add a simple green salad dressed with olive oil and lemon. For packed lunches, keep any fresh greens separate until eating so the bowl maintains its contrast in texture.

Questions people ask

Can I use chicken thighs instead of breasts?

Yes. Use boneless, skinless thighs and roast until the thickest part reaches 165°F. Their varying thickness may change the oven time, so check them individually instead of relying only on the clock.

Can I cook the quinoa ahead?

Yes. Cook and cool the quinoa, then refrigerate it in a covered container. Warm it with a small splash of water before assembling, or use it cold for a lunch bowl with the chicken and vegetables.
